Book excerpt: “After all, what is mythology if not a fragment of history unexplored?” Ravish, an IGS (Intelligence Groups and Services) agent, suffering from serious mental health issues which doesn’t let him concentrate on his work, is rudely jerked back into action when a mysterious caller at night gives him a sinister warning. Ravish gets his old IGS team 'The Rig' back when he learns that his mentor Sanjay has been murdered in cold blood. He realises the caller’s threats have actual deep implications and informs his team. Meanwhile, Mrityunjay, his old enemy unearths some secrets of Indian Mythology and possibly the most dangerous secret ever. He with his society 'The Ajayas' plans to commit something sinister which would have deep reaching implications within society. Then begins the thrilling tale of 'The Rig' going up against 'The Ajayas' in a bid to keep the world order balanced. Filled with mystery, thrill and adventure, the story will keep readers guessing. 'The Rig Chronicles: The Secret of the Sudarshan' is one of those novels that explores the possibilities that Indian Mythology has in store for us. What was the secret of India’s most potent ancient weapon? Why did Lord Krishna not fight the Mahabharata war? Would Ravish and ‘The Rig’ be able to prevent Mrityunjay from destroying everything? Book excerpt: Fauji Heart is a captivating set of short stories, where each one has a unique flavor and yet together they build up a whole and nuanced picture of the Indian soldier. One where he is not a unidimensional stereotype of a brave-heart sworn to protect the nation, but a real, breathing, complex human being living an undoubtedly odd but fulfilling life. This collection offers a rare insight into army life that is sometimes mundane…sometimes fantastic, sometimes humourous…sometimes tragic, sometimes lonely…but always filled with adventure. ‘Civilian’ readers will enjoy this experience of engaging with the fauji world in such a real manner...beyond the tragic headlines or the usual patriotic rhetoric. Though most of the stories are set in the 70’s, 80’s and 90’s they will undoubtedly resonate with old faujis and the new generation alike.
